🎤 Speaker: Professor Paul Howard-Jones is a Professor of Neuroscience and Education at School of Education, University of Bristol. Professor Paul’s work has been focusing on issues at the interface of cognitive neuroscience and educational theory, practice and policy. He has applied diverse research methods from computational brain imaging studies to classroom observations in order to understand learning processes and their potential relevance to educational learning. He has authored numerous reviews and books about the science of learning (most recently “Evolution of the Learning Brain”, published by Routledge). His broadcasting work includes writing and presenting the R4 series “In Search of Eden”, and presenting on the BAFTA-nominated Channel 4 series “Secret Life of Four Year Olds”.
Experience Description
Creativity involves transforming your ideas, dreams and imagination into reality; naturally, it is highly coveted in all walks of life. But where does it come from, and how can we nurture it? Are we doomed to have the creativity that is written in our genes, or can we develop creativity through practice? In this engaging lecture, you'll learn about the relationship between creativity and intelligence as well as the way the brain operates during the creative process. Who knows, maybe you'll unlock your creative genius, too!
